Math Methods Versus Math Tricks


This week's Sunday reflection comes from Jim Propp in a recent Web piece:
"Mathematicians are people who like solving problems, and have the persistence to work on problems that take time to solve, and have collected a mental tool-kit consisting of methods that have helped them solve problems in the past. Some mathematicians distinguish between methods and tricks. A method is a tool that solves more than one problem, while a trick is a tool that applies to only one. Under this definition, I’d say that there are no tricks in math, and part of the discipline of getting good at math is to study every trick you encounter until you see the method hiding inside it."

Tuesday, January 19, 2016

Props to Propp...


Everyone probably knows Jordan Ellenberg's fabulous bestseller from a few years back, "How Not To Be Wrong." A few days ago at "Mathematical Enchantments" Jim Propp put up one of the odder math posts I've seen in quite awhile (and a bit longish, but nonetheless entertaining) entitled (taking off from Jordan), "How To Be Wrong." It has to do with the benefit of teachers, for the sake of teaching, making mistakes and facing them square-on... and, not being too dogmatic or pompous along the way; what he calls "the art of being wrong":
 
https://mathenchant.wordpress.com/2016/01/16/how-to-be-wrong/

At one cogent point Propp writes:
"I stress to my students that the earlier you make your mistakes, the better.  Every mistake you make in the classroom, or on your homework, is a mistake you probably won’t make on the exam, where mistakes can really hurt you.  And, carrying this idea further: a mistake you make in college or graduate school is a mistake you’re less likely to make after you graduate, when you’re building bridges or designing cancer treatment protocols. So my answer to the question 'How to be wrong?' is: 'Early and often!'”
